EXECUTIVE SUMMARY
A survey was conducted to understand peoples perception about efficient/alternate fuels like
CNG/LPG for cars. A questionnaire was prepared for the survey which was filled up by the
non-commercial car drivers. Non-commercial drivers were selected as the sample because the
focus of the survey is to check out peoples awareness about efficient fuel and their benefits.
The survey was very helpful as it thrower light on peoples awareness about availability of
fuel efficient cars, would they prefer buying fuel efficient cars, damage caused to
environment due to air pollution by fuels like petrol and diesel.
The survey also helped to understand the likings and disliking of an individual while
purchasing a car or what are the factors that are considered by him/her while buying a new
car.
The survey was conducted at petrol pumps as it is the only place where the potential car
driver could be found and to find out which type of fuel is used for his/her car.
The survey was conducted at petrol pumps in areas like Mumbai, Navi-Mumbai & Thaneetc
which are densely populated consisting lot of car drivers.
The findings of the survey were studied and it was found out that 26.53% of people use petrol
cars, 20.4% of people use diesel cars, and 53.06% of people use alternate fuels out of total
number of 49 surveys done.

LITERATURE REVIEW
Recently, an alarming phenomenon has been taking place. In the last few months, fuel prices
have been increasing at high rates which have led to individuals rethinking their automobile
purchases. For those people who are currently in the market for a new vehicle, the high price
of fuel has pushed them to consider other, more fuel efficient automobiles.
Another most important reason why car buyers are looking into the purchase of a more fuel-
efficient car is due to the environment pollution. The less fuel a car uses, the more
environment friendly that vehicle is. There are a number of different types of pollution which
are directly related to automobile use. Therefore individuals are looking out for vehicles that
will use eco-friendly fuel to make the car sound environment friendly overall.
Those who loved petrol, scoffed at it, and those who admired diesel ridiculed it as its poor
Cousin. But no more. Increasingly
worried over frequent rise in the
prices of petrol and diesel, car
buyers have fallen in love with
compressed natural gas (CNG) that
offers higher fuel efficiency and
lower running cost. And carmakers
are quick to take note of this trend.
"We were expecting this to happen, that's why our CNG-based models have been consistently
doing well. But the recent demand has increased the waiting period for CNG models, says
Maruti Suzuki India CGM (Marketing) Shashank Srivastava. India's largest carmaker
launched five petrol cars-Sx4, Alto, WagonR, Estilo and Eeco -with CNG-integrated injectors
in November last year to cater to the demand for the clean fuel-fitted vehicles among
customers in urban markets.
Working their strategies around shifting consumer behavior in urban areas, several carmakers
have now loaded CNG technology into their popular models such as Hyundai Accent, GM
Aveo, Toyota Innova and Corolla, Tata Indica and Indigo in order to tap the growing demand

for the cleanest and cheapest fuel, which is now available only in Delhi, Mumbai, Agra and
Gujarat.
While Maruti is planning to extend the CNG technology to its other models, GM India is
planning to roll out new cars such as Beat on the same fuel.
In fact, country's second largest carmaker-Hyundai Motor India-is witnessing a revival in
demand for its CNG models.
"We have seen a revival in demand for the Accent CNG, which now has a waiting period, as
customers are shifting to cheaper fuel options, says Hyundai director for marketing & sales
Arvind Saxena.
Cheaper running cost has been influencing customer decision and the market was gradually
moving towards diesel cars, but recent hike in its price has made CNG the best fuel option.
While it costs 4.40 per kilometer to run a petrol version of Maruti Sx4, the diesel variant
costs 2.40. Now compare this with a CNG version that costs only 1.50 per km! No wonder,
car buyers in National Capital Region have lapped up CNG models over the last year. Sale of
CNG-fitted cars in NCR has jumped 43% over the last year to touch 4.5-lakh mark by May-
end this year.
Even though electric cars such as Reva have a running cost of around 50 paise per km, they
are largely unviable due to the huge battery cost and lack of charging options.
Reva's ex-showroom price of around 4-lakh makes it much expensive than popular five-seater
like the WagonR that starts at 3.3 lakh in Delhi.
Despite its limited availability, auto analysts feel that CNG has now become reliable as well
as popular among car users.
"There is great push for cars offering lower running cost. CNG-based technology has been
consistently reliable in India for the past decade, which has become popular as companies
have launched the technology in their popular cars," says Abdul Majeed partner automotive
practice with PWC.
Delhi's experiment with greening of public transport has rung a bell at Copenhagen.
Indraprastha Gas Ltd, the city's sole supplier of CNG (compressed natural gas), has been

invited to a parallel show of the summit on global warming to tell the world how natural gas
can play a role in mitigating climate change by reducing vehicular emission.
IGL managing director Rajesh Vedvyas said the company has been invited by IGU
(International Gas Union) to a conference that is being conducted on the sidelines of the
climate change summit to promote use of gas as green fuel. ''It is recognition of the good
work done by IGL and credit goes to the people, institutions and promoters who have
supported it in improving air quality in the city.'' IGL was set up under the Supreme Court's
directive and has been credited with helping reduce vehicular pollution levels.
IGL is a joint venture between GAIL, Bharat Petroleum and Delhi government. IGU is a
global body of gas producing and consuming technologies, and focuses on raising production
of natural gas and increasing efficiency in its use. IGL fuels nearly three lakh vehicles
both public and private that run in Delhi and its satellite towns. The number of cars
running on CNG has recorded 43% rise year-on-year.
The number of private cars running on CNG in Delhi has risen 43% year-on-year, even as
more than 3,700 such automobiles continue to be added to the clean-fuel transport fleet.
A survey commissioned by IGL found 175,313 private CNG cars against 122,485 in March
last year. The survey, conducted in April-May period, sees number of private vehicles
running on CNG exceeding 2.5 lakh by the time Delhi hosts the Commonwealth Games in
October next year.

CONCLUSION
It is concluded from the result that though customers have an opinion that they are aware
about the Environment Friendly Car (EFC) but it is very clearly from the results that more
awareness has to be created in non metros. As India is growing in the rural and metros seem
to be saturated it is more important to focus on non-metro. While testing the awareness of the
customers on the academic front there is no difference in the awareness level. The awareness
levels are very generic and detail knowledge of the disposal of the car, the batteries and the
typesets is missing amongst the customer. These are very damaging when it comes to the
impact on the mother earth. The results indicate that the awareness amongst the various age
groups is similar and hence the marketer and the government should create the desiredknowledge and effective use of media should be made so that people are made aware of the
environment problem arising out of the cars being used. New papers being the most effective
media the benefits regarding EFC should be made public.
